[QUOTE="JoKalsbeek, post: 1957796, member: 401801"] Couple of things here: Why can't you keep track? What medication are you on? Have you tried a low carb diet? Why do you think intravenous food will help? Most of that usually consists of carbohydrates, they'd make your bloodsugar skyrocket, while it's pretty much okay from the look of it now... It's a bit of a drastic measure that probably wouldn't actually help you. Where did you get this idea? Better to see what's going wrong with the diabetes management, and see what can get fixed there. But honestly, if you're hovering between 4 and 9.... I'm not seeing very bad numbers. Bloodsugars fluctuate throughout the day, that's normal. If you're thinking a constant influx of food would be better, it would [I]not[/I] be. You're supposed to go up and down, give your pancreas a break every now and again, not keep it working continuously. Maybe read the Diabetes code by Dr. Jason Fung? That might be helpful? [/QUOTE]
